Old Dominion Freight Line, Inc. is currently recruiting Management Trainees who will receive hands-on training in all wage and salaried jobs to learn to manage a shift or an operational area in a service center.

Once hands-on training is completed in each area the trainee fills in as a supervisor on various shifts and departments.

The trainee will learn to manage a shift while emphasizing safety, quality, efficiency, service, and delivery. The trainee also completes assignments while being assessed through knowledge indicators, writing papers, viewing management videos, and recommending process improvements on operating procedures.

Participates in Old Dominion Truck Driving Training program to receive a CDL license, participates in forklift training program and management and leadership training courses as scheduled.

Responsibilities

  • Complete shift manager’s training as an understudy with an experienced manager or supervisor.
  • Trainees will complete forklift job training knowledge and production exercises on all jobs within the service center.
  • Trainees will participate in ODTDT (Old Dominion Truck Driving Training) program to obtain CDL license.
  • Fill in as a supervisor on various shifts and departments.
  • Completes department / area knowledge indicators and develops new indicators as well as process and procedure changes.
  • Works in AS400 moving freight as needed throughout the system and maintains records of efficiency, quality, cost, hot loads, missed loads, etc.
  • Works in Workday as needed to update payroll and employee information.
  • Writes and submits monthly activity reports.
  • Assigns work to employees according to daily schedule.
  • Makes quick and informed decisions based on the volume levels and communicates schedule to affected employees.
  • Inspects working conditions of tools and equipment needed for safe operation within the area and directs the correction of any improper or adverse condition that exists.
  • Approximately 15% travel to other service centers to learn the operations and supervise in a different environment.
